Interface ApplicationListener<E extends ApplicationEvent>

Type Parameters:
E - the specific ApplicationEvent subclass to listen to
All Superinterfaces:
EventListener
All Known Subinterfaces:
GenericApplicationListener, SmartApplicationListener, TransactionalApplicationListener<E>
All Known Implementing Classes:
ApplicationListenerMethodAdapter, DefaultSimpUserRegistry, GenericApplicationListenerAdapter, JmsListenerEndpointRegistry, MultiServerUserRegistry, ResourceUrlProvider, ResourceUrlProvider, ScheduledAnnotationBeanPostProcessor, SourceFilteringListener, TransactionalApplicationListenerAdapter, TransactionalApplicationListenerMethodAdapter, UserRegistryMessageHandler
Functional Interface:
This is a functional interface and can therefore be used as the assignment target for a lambda expression or method reference.

@FunctionalInterface public interface ApplicationListener<E extends ApplicationEvent> extends EventListener
Interface to be implemented by application event listeners.

Based on the standard EventListener interface for the Observer design pattern.

An ApplicationListener can generically declare the event type that it is interested in. When registered with a Spring ApplicationContext, events will be filtered accordingly, with the listener getting invoked for matching event objects only.

  • Method Details

    • onApplicationEvent

      void onApplicationEvent(E event)
      Handle an application event.
      Parameters:
      event - the event to respond to
    • forPayload

      static <T> ApplicationListener<PayloadApplicationEvent<T>> forPayload(Consumer<T> consumer)
      Create a new ApplicationListener for the given payload consumer.
      Type Parameters:
      T - the type of the event payload
      Parameters:
      consumer - the event payload consumer
      Returns:
      a corresponding ApplicationListener instance
      Since:
      5.3
